What makes pole barn construction ideal for rural properties?

Pole barns offer cost-effective, open-span structures that accommodate equipment storage, livestock housing, and workshop spaces without complex foundations.

Traditional foundations require extensive excavation and curing time. Pole barns use treated posts embedded directly in the ground or set on concrete footings, reducing construction time and cost. The post-frame design supports wide, column-free interiors perfect for storing tractors, hay, and machinery.

Metal roofing and siding resist fire, pests, and rot better than wood structures. Ventilation options and insulation packages adapt the building for year-round use. Landowners customize door sizes, window placement, and interior layouts to match specific agricultural or storage requirements.

How do you choose the right size and layout?

Building size depends on equipment dimensions, future storage needs, and available lot space, while layout planning addresses door placement and workflow efficiency.

Measure your largest equipment and add clearance for maneuvering. Plan for growth by sizing the building to accommodate future machinery or seasonal storage needs. Door height and width must fit tractors, trailers, and vehicles you'll move in and out regularly.

Interior layout options include partitioned stalls, loft storage, and dedicated workshop areas. Electrical and plumbing rough-ins can be included during construction if the building will support tools, lighting, or livestock watering systems. Experienced builders review site conditions, setbacks, and access routes before finalizing plans.

Which materials ensure long-term durability?

Treated posts, engineered trusses, and metal roofing and siding deliver decades of reliable performance with minimal maintenance in Michigan's climate.

Pressure-treated posts resist ground moisture and insect damage. Engineered trusses handle snow loads and span wide interiors without sagging. Metal roofing sheds snow quickly and resists wind uplift, while metal siding withstands impacts and weather exposure better than traditional barn siding.

Color-coated metal panels resist fading and corrosion. Fastener systems include weather-tight gaskets that prevent leaks around screws. Proper ventilation prevents condensation inside the building, protecting stored equipment and materials from rust and mold.

How do Calhoun County building codes affect pole barn projects?

Local zoning and setback requirements in Battle Creek and surrounding Calhoun County areas determine building placement, size limits, and permit requirements before construction begins.

Agricultural zones typically allow larger structures with fewer restrictions, but residential and mixed-use parcels may have setback distances from property lines and height limits. Permit applications require site plans showing building footprint, location, and compliance with local codes. Contractors familiar with county regulations streamline the permit process and ensure your pole barn meets all requirements.

Soil conditions and drainage also influence post depth and footing design. Properties with high water tables or clay soils may need deeper posts or gravel backfill to ensure stability and prevent frost heave during winter freeze-thaw cycles.
